Country singer Travis Tritt is infamous in political circles for not only being a right wing loon, but also preemptively blocking everyone on Twitter who doesn’t lean his way politically (including Palmer Report). Tritt has also set up shop on Donald Trump’s Truth Social platform, where he has a verified account with an almost hilariously unrealistically large number of supposed followers.

So what does Travis Tritt’s Truth Social account look like? A few days ago he posted that he has “confidential sources in Georgia” who have told him that Georgia’s Republican Governor Brian Kemp “cut a deal with the state of Georgia to select Dominion Voting Systems to provide its new statewide voting system beginning in 2020. My sources tell me that Kemp has never been in debt since that deal was done. Connect the dots.” Uh, no. Where do we even start with this crap?

This is so bizarrely unhinged, it’s beyond ludicrous. There is no evidence that Kemp has ever been massively in debt. Nor is it sane to believe that Kemp cut a secret deal with a voting machine company. This is rubber room lunatic stuff. Even if this kind of evidence did exist (which it doesn’t), anyone in possession of this evidence would be going public with it – not giving an exclusive about it to Travis Tritt.

For that matter, was Tritt asleep when the whole Dominion vs Fox News thing happened? Is he really stupid enough to make this kind of stuff up about Dominion, after everything that’s happened? This is nuts.
